After Sheik pinned Creed using the ropes, Creed complained so the ref restarted the match. Creed went for a sunset flip but Sheik held the ropes. The ref kicked him "accidentally" and Creed got the win. Sheik started shoving him (I forget the ref's name) and slapped him, trying to provoke him. Finally, the ref fought back with some chops and even a back body drop. Then clotheslined him out of the ring and Hebner came in to calm him down.

To answer Thrilla, they made an announcement that next week Love would face Wilde in a "Beauty Pageant". Bikini contest, talent competition and something else I forget.

Beer Money just beat PJB while Curry Man got beat down by Rock N Rave, then an ambush by LAX followed. Salinas made an appearance after :D
